Atlas® AF13G — 13 HP (Honda GX390, Electric Start) Air Compressor

Remote job sites, mobile service trucks, and shops without reliable 220V power still need real commercial air output — running a generator just to power an electric compressor adds a point of failure a gas engine skips entirely.

The Atlas® AF13G is a gas-powered 2-stage reciprocating compressor rated for 13 HP (Honda GX390, Electric Start) with a 30 gallon horizontal tank, built for shops and commercial operations that need compressed air on tap all day without paying for accessories they don’t need.

Who the AF13G Is Built For

  • ✅ Mobile service trucks and roadside repair operations that need strong air supply with zero dependence on electrical hookups
  • ✅ Construction sites and remote job locations where there's no shop power, but pneumatic tools still need to run
  • ✅ Fleet or field-service techs who need to run large impact wrenches and air tools on location instead of hauling vehicles back to the shop
  • ✅ Operations that value the reliability of a Honda GX390 engine — a widely-serviced, parts-available platform for field equipment
  • ✅ Buyers who need a horizontal tank and compact footprint that mounts easily on a service truck bed or trailer
  • ✅ Shops that occasionally need backup air supply during a power outage, or a crew working in a building under construction where electrical service hasn’t been run to the site yet

What the AF13G Is NOT Built For

  • ❌ Shop-based operations with standard electrical service already available — an electric AF-series unit (like the AF9) delivers more CFM per dollar when you don't need gas portability
  • ❌ Indoor, enclosed-space use — like any gas engine, the AF13G needs ventilation and should not run in an unventilated shop bay
  • ❌ Buyers needing more than 25 CFM continuous — the 14HP Kohler-powered AF14G offers a modest step up, or consider an electric multi-HP unit for shop-based heavy use

What Makes the AF13G Different

Commercial 2-Stage Pump

The AF13G uses a 2-Cylinder, 2-Stage pump built for daily, all-day duty cycles — not a hobby-grade single-stage unit that struggles under continuous shop use.

CFM & Pressure Output

Delivers 25 CFM @ 90 PSI and holds pressure across a 145–175 PSI range, enough headroom to run impact wrenches, tire equipment, and paint tools without the tank running dry.

Full Specifications — AF13G

Model / Part Number ATEMPAF13G-FPD
Horsepower 13 HP (Honda GX390, Electric Start)
Pump 2-Cylinder, 2-Stage
Configuration Gas-Powered 2-Stage Reciprocating
Tank 30 Gallon Horizontal
CFM @ 90 PSI 25 CFM @ 90 PSI
CFM @ 175 PSI 19 CFM @ 175 PSI
Pressure Range 145–175 PSI
Overall Dimensions 46" L × 19" W × 37" H
Shipping Weight 627 lbs
Warranty 1-year parts only

Frequently Asked Questions — Atlas® AF13G

Does the AF13G need electrical power?

No — the AF13G runs entirely on its Honda GX390 gas engine with electric start. No shop power or electrical hookup is required, making it ideal for mobile and remote job sites.

Can I run the AF13G indoors?

No. Like any gas engine, the AF13G produces exhaust and needs open-air ventilation. Do not run it in an enclosed shop bay or building without proper ventilation.

What is the AF13G's warranty?

Atlas backs the AF13G with a 1-year parts-only warranty. Alamo handles warranty service locally — call (844) 480-6059 instead of waiting on a manufacturer hotline.

What's the difference between the AF13G and the AF14G?

The AF13G uses a 13HP Honda GX390 engine; the AF14G uses a 14HP Kohler CH440 engine. Both share the same 30-gallon horizontal tank, 2-stage pump, and CFM output — the choice mostly comes down to engine-brand preference and parts availability in your area.
